Quantib Prostate is an advanced AI-driven software designed specifically to enhance the efficiency and accuracy of prostate MRI readings. Its primary goal is to support radiologists by automating key tasks such as the segmentation of the prostate and the identification of suspicious regions of interest. The software also integrates PSA density calculations and provides support for PI-RADS scoring, which standardizes reporting processes. As part of a broader health informatics portfolio, Quantib Prostate is both FDA-cleared and CE-marked, demonstrating its compliance with rigorous safety and efficacy standards.
